This black steel picture light brings focused, adjustable illumination to a favourite painting or family portrait without dominating the wall. Compact in scale at 18.2 cm wide and projecting 18.6 cm from the wall, it suits a narrow hallway, a study wall, or a gallery run in the lounge room where several smaller works hang together. The shade sits below a slim rectangular back plate, connected by a pair of jointed arms that let you angle the light down onto the piece beneath.
- Double knuckle joints on each arm mean the shade tilts and swivels independently, so light lands precisely on the canvas rather than spilling onto the wall around it.
- Takes a single E14 candle globe (not included) rated up to 40W — pair it with the recommended 4W LED for a warm, gallery-quality glow that costs little to run.
- Compatible with dimmable lamps, so brightness can be softened for evening viewing or brought up for detailed study of a portrait.
- Runs on standard 220-240V mains power, with Class I wiring for straightforward, safe hardwiring by an electrician.
- Solid steel construction and a compact back plate (16.8 cm high, 6 cm wide) keep the fitting neat against the wall, weighing under a kilogram.
